Output d035be6e7031768ab92dc42afc872dd498116a519fbf7b2fc6fe07895a0b0412:118

value
31989
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f8f76e764f4a3de22285b95980c6eace21cfff0 OP_EQUAL
address
3En6R4XBfZ6eUJvhh6H1NvU5JDNrcppKun
transaction
d035be6e7031768ab92dc42afc872dd498116a519fbf7b2fc6fe07895a0b0412
confirmations
66777
spent
true